- Reduced Box Office Revenue
The availability of movies through unauthorized channels often leads to a decline in box office revenue. Viewers may opt to access films at no cost instead of purchasing tickets for a theatrical experience. This reduction in ticket sales directly impacts revenue for film studios, distributors, and theater owners, potentially impacting the financial viability of future productions.
- Diminished Revenue from Streaming and Digital Sales
Unauthorized downloads and streams of movies often precede authorized releases on streaming platforms and digital marketplaces. This prior availability can reduce demand for these paid services, significantly impacting the revenue generated through subscriptions and digital purchases. Studios and distributors may need to alter strategies to combat this loss of revenue.
- Impact on Production Budgets
The decrease in revenue stemming from unauthorized distribution has a direct bearing on production budgets. Fewer resources available for productions may lead to compromises in quality, scale, and scope of future films. This impact can cascade throughout the supply chain, affecting employment in various roles related to film production.
- Decreased Investment in Filmmaking
Reduced revenue streams discourage further investment in the film industry. The persistent threat of unauthorized distribution can make potential investors hesitant, hindering the creation of new films and potentially leading to a decline in creativity and innovation within the industry. This concern extends beyond individual film production and affects the entire sector, potentially slowing down future artistic endeavors.

5. Legal Ramifications
Legal ramifications are inextricably linked to the practice of "latest movies free download." The unauthorized distribution of copyrighted material, a core component of this practice, triggers a range of legal actions. Copyright law, designed to protect the rights of creators and distributors, forms the basis for these actions. Violations of copyright, often facilitated by readily available online platforms, expose individuals and organizations to significant legal repercussions. These ramifications can encompass both civil and criminal penalties, depending on the scale and nature of the infringement.
Legal frameworks are critical for maintaining a balanced environment where creators are compensated for their work and consumers have access to content through legitimate means. Real-world examples illustrate the consequences. Individuals and entities found to be distributing unauthorized movies face legal challenges ranging from cease-and-desist letters to substantial monetary penalties, legal injunctions, and, in severe cases, criminal charges. Jurisdictional differences further complicate this issue, as legal enforcement varies across countries. Websites operating torrent sites, for example, have faced legal action in various jurisdictions for facilitating the distribution of copyrighted movies. This highlights the significant importance of adhering to copyright laws for both individuals and companies involved in the digital distribution of content.

Question 1: Is it legal to download movies for free?
No. Downloading or streaming movies without authorization is generally illegal in most jurisdictions. Copyright laws protect the intellectual property rights of filmmakers, distributors, and studios. Unauthorized distribution violates these rights and can lead to legal penalties for individuals or organizations involved.
Question 2: What are the potential legal consequences of downloading movies without authorization?
Legal consequences can vary but may include monetary penalties, legal injunctions, and, in extreme cases, criminal charges. The severity of the penalties depends on factors such as the scale of the infringement, the specific laws of the jurisdiction, and the involvement of a company or organization.
Question 3: How does downloading movies without authorization impact the film industry?
The unauthorized distribution of films significantly impacts the film industry's revenue streams. Lost revenue from box office sales, streaming subscriptions, and other ancillary products diminishes the financial resources available for film production, marketing, and the livelihood of industry professionals. This ultimately affects the production and distribution of future films.
Question 4: Are there any ethical considerations regarding "latest movies free download"?
Ethical considerations center around respect for intellectual property rights. Downloading movies without authorization constitutes a form of theft, violating the ethical principle of fair compensation for creative work. This activity discourages future creative endeavors and compromises the financial sustainability of the entertainment industry.
Question 5: What are the alternatives to downloading movies without authorization?
Legitimate alternatives for accessing movies include purchasing movies on streaming services, renting films, or attending theatrical screenings. These options offer a way to enjoy movies while upholding the legal and ethical principles of fair use and copyright protection.
